Transaction 3017bbf00caa55855126c26163a515ab569c43bf4d9089e4c9524bc0e570bbae

1 Input
2 Outputs
  • 3017bbf00caa55855126c26163a515ab569c43bf4d9089e4c9524bc0e570bbae:0
  • value  231234
    address  bc1qrkassvkgze4npd225zxjwgaeghvvlze4gd6m0p
  • 3017bbf00caa55855126c26163a515ab569c43bf4d9089e4c9524bc0e570bbae:1
  • value  123696
    address  3R2DUukby7BPuRgqWkATmC1vE8QrHvxShs